path.diagram: Diagrama de trilha com efeitos diretos e indiretos

Description Usage Arguments Author(s)

Description

Confecciona um diagrama de trilha dos efeitos diretos e indiretos com base em um modelo ajustado pela função "path.coef", ou qualquer matrix quadrada (simétrica ou não simétrica).

Usage

1
2
3
4
5
6
7
path.diagram(x, digits = 3, symetrical = TRUE, curve = 0, pos = NULL,
        diag = TRUE,relsize = 1, dtext = 0.15, lwd = 1, lcol = "black",
        box.lwd = 0.5, cex.txt = 0.8, box.type = "hexa", box.size = 0.08,
        box.prop = 0.5, box.col = "gray90", arr.type = "curved", arr.pos = 0.4,
        arr.lwd = 1, arr.col = NULL, arr.length = 0.4, arr.width = 0.2,
        export = FALSE, file.type = "pdf", file.name = NULL, width = 8,
        height = 7, resolution = 300, ...)

Arguments

x

O objeto Coeff criado pela função path.coeff, ou qualquer matrix quadrada

digits

O número de dígitos significativos a ser plotado.

symetrical

Argumento lógico, padrão TRUE. Válido quando o diagrama é confeccionado com base em uma matriz externa. Se FALSE, os valores das duas diagonais (superior e inferior) são plotados

curve

Um valor, ou matriz da mesma dimensão de Coeff especificando a curvatura das setas. Padrão é 0, sem curvatura.

pos

Um vetor especificando o número de elementos em cada linha do gráfico.

diag

Argumento lógico, padrão TRUE. Se FALSE, os efeitos diretos não são plotados.

relsize

Tamanho relativo do gráfico. Parão é 1.

dtext

controla a posição do texto da seta em relação à ponta da seta. Padrão é 0.15.

lwd

Largura da linha para as setas e caixas.

lcol

Cor da linha para setas e caixas.

box.lwd

largura da linha da caixa, um valor ou um vetor com dimensão = número de linhas de Coeff.

cex.txt

tamanho relativo do texto da seta, um valor ou uma matriz com as mesmas dimensões de Coeff

box.type

Forma da caixa (rect, ellipse, diamond, round, hexa, multi), um valor ou um vector com dimensão = número de linhas de Coeff.

box.size

Tamanho da caixa, um valor ou um vetor com dimensão = número de linhas de Coeff.

box.prop

relação comprimento / largura da caixa, um valor ou um vetor com dimensão = número de linhas de Coeff.

box.col

Cor da caixa. Um valor ou um vetor com dimesão = número de linhas de Coeff.

arr.type

tipo de ponta da seta, um de ("curved", "triangle", "circle", "ellipse", "T", "simple"), um valor ou uma matriz com as mesmas dimensões de Coeff.

arr.pos

posição relativa da ponta da seta no segmento / curva da seta, um valor ou uma matriz com as mesmas dimensões que Coeff.

arr.lwd

largura da linha da seta, conectando dois pontos diferentes, um valor ou uma matriz com as mesmas dimensões que Coeff.

arr.col

cor da ponta da seta, um valor ou uma matriz com as mesmas dimensões que Coeff.

arr.length

comprimento da seta, um valor ou uma matriz com as mesmas dimensões que Coeff.

arr.width

largura da seta, um valor ou uma matriz com as mesmas dimensões que Coeff.

export

Argumento lógico para exportação do gráfico. Padrão é FALSE.

file.type

O tipo de arquivo a ser exportado. Argumento válido se export = T|TRUE. Padrão é "pdf". O gráfico também pode ser exportado em formato *.tiff declarando file.type = "tiff".

file.name

O nome do arquivo para exportação. Padrão é NULL, ou seja, o arquivo é nomeado automaticamente.

width

A largura em "inch" do gráfico. Padrão é 8.

height

A algura em "inch" do gráfico. Padrão é 7.

resolution

A resolução da imagem. Argumento válido se file.type = "tiff" é declarado. Padrão é 300 (300 dpi)

...

Outros argumentos importados das funções plotmat() do pacote diagram.

Author(s)

Tiago Olivoto tiagoolivoto@gmail.com


TiagoOlivoto/cursoR documentation built on May 13, 2019, 1:23 p.m.